WEIDNER, J.,

Petitioner, Merle E. Mixell, Jr., and Sharon K. Mixell were married on April 27, 1974. On September 21, 1974, a child, Christopher E. Mixell, was born to Sharon K. Mixell. Thereafter, Sharon K. Mixell instituted proceedings against petitioner for support and maintenance of this child. On January 10, 1975, petitioner entered into a support agreement whereby he agreed to contribute $20 per week for the support of said child. Subsequently, however, arrearages in these support payments arose.
